In a glimpse into her early years, a unique and intriguing facet of Jessica Chastain‘s character emerges. Long before she became a celebrated actress, Chastain’s desire for attention was evident even in her school days. A rather unconventional tactic she employed to captivate her peers involved an unexpected and curious act: she ingeniously made her classmates watch as she consumed orange and banana peels. The actress revealed:

“I remember sitting in the cafeteria and eating orange peels and banana peels because it made people notice me. The other kids would be like, ‘Oh my God, look at her.’ I know, it’s terrible. I just wanted people to notice me for being a weirdo, that I was existing, something.”

Chastain delvs into her childhood fascination with banana peels around the 40-minute mark in the podcast by WTF with Marc Maron Podcast. Jessica Chastain’s acting career began on the stage, with her performing in various theater productions. She made her on-screen debut in 2004 with a guest role on the television series ER. However, her breakthrough came in 2011 with a series of acclaimed performances in films like The Tree of Life and The Help. Her role as Celia Foote in The Help earned her an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actress.

Beyond her acting career, Chastain has used her platform to advocate for gender equality and to raise awareness about issues within the entertainment industry. She has been outspoken about the gender pay gap and the need for more diverse and complex roles for women in film.
